Cognition: An Erica Reed Thriller – Episode 4: The Cain Killer Review

Eduardo ReboucasSeptember 19, 2013June 3, 202103 mins

After months of carefully putting together puzzles and helping agent Reed along in her investigation, it’s finally time to end it all. Cognition: An Erica Reed Thriller comes to a satisfying close when Erica finally comes face-to-face with the Cain Killer in arguably the best episode of the season. Cognition: Episode 2 – The Wise Monkey Review

Eduardo ReboucasFebruary 10, 2013April 28, 202504 mins

Cogntion: An Erica Reed Thriller is getting scarier and grittier with each new episode. The Wise Monkey, the second chapter in Cognition continues to deliver an impressive and surprisingly mature narrative, with yet another chilling, yet exciting investigation that picks up from where The Hangman left off.
